Sail Area Breakdown

Calculated from rigging dimensions. Use these as your starting point when ordering a new suit.

SailArea (ft²)Area (m²)
MainsailP × E ÷ 2 207.0 19.2
100% ForetriangleI × J ÷ 2 285.0 26.5
150% GenoaTypical light-air headsail 427.5 39.7
Storm Jib~50% of foretriangle, high-cut 142.5 13.2
Symmetric SpinnakerEstimated from I, J 1,026.0 95.3
Total Working Sail AreaMain + 100% foretriangle 492.0 45.7

Typical Sail Inventory

What Dockrell 37 owners usually carry and what's worth buying used vs. new.

Mainsail 207.0 ft²
Dacron cross-cut with 2 reef points is standard. Full-batten is a common upgrade.
Replace new
150% Genoa 427.5 ft²
The workhorse headsail. Most boats have one on a furler by now.
Replace new
110% Working Jib ~314 ft²
Good secondary sail for breezy days — used market is strong.
Buy used
Storm Jib 142.5 ft²
Bright orange recommended. Rarely used, hard to justify new.
Buy used
Asymmetric Spinnaker ~1,026 ft²
Popular downwind upgrade — easier than symmetric for shorthanded sailing.
